On 10/17/01 8:33 AM, "Ralph Brown" <php4u at pacbell.net> wrote:

> 
> I have just configured Bind on RH 7.1, but noticed that my mail client, on a
> different node, can not retrieve mail? I can get mail from the mail client
> on the RH node just fine.
> 
> Also, I am unable to get a node "g4" to serve up via DNS. I can pull up web
> pages from this node via IP#, but not by name " g4.policing.net" ??
> 
> Suggestions please
> Thanks in advance!
> Ralph
> 
> Here is my named.conf file:
> 
> ## named.conf - configuration for bind
> #
> 
> options {
>       directory "/var/named/";
> 
> forwarders {
> 206.13.28.12;
> 206.13.30.12;
> 
> };
> 
> };
> 
> 
> zone  "." {
>       type hint;
>       file  "named.ca";
> };
> 
> 
> zone "policing.net" {
> type master;
> file "db.policing.net";
> };
> 
> 
> zone  "0.0.127.in-addr.arpa" {
>       type master;
>       file  "0.0.127.in-addr.arpa.zone";
> };
> zone  "123.168.192-in.addr.arpa" {
>       type master;
>       file  "db.123.168.192";
> };
